Out Where the Stars Begin is a 1938 musical comedy directed by Bobby Connolly. This short film features a plot revolving around a ballerina's dramatic exit and her understudy's rise to fame.
Features lively musical numbers typical of the late 30s. Β· The dynamic between director and ballerina adds an interesting layer. Β· Good example of period dance and performance styles.

Out Where the Stars Begin is a musical comedy.
The film was directed by Bobby Connolly.
The runtime of Out Where the Stars Begin is 19 minutes.
